Juicy Roasted Rosemary Chicken

This brined chicken recipe is always a hit at family dinners. Tender, juicy and deliciously flavored with garlic and fresh rosemary, everyone will be coming back for seconds! Bon appétit!

Constanza Oriani

Ingredients

Brine

  • A whole chicken, approx. 1.4 kg
  • ¼ cup of Herbamare Original
  • 2 tbsp each of sugar and pepper
  • 2 smashed garlic cloves

Ingredients for Juicy Roasted Rosemary Chicken

  • 2 tbsp olive oil
  • 2 tbsp butter, unsalted
  • 7 cloves garlic
  • 7 fresh sprigs of rosemary
  • Herbamare® Original to taste
  • Pepper to taste
  • 4 Yukon Gold potatoes, peeled and cut into quarters lengthwise

How to make Juicy Roasted Rosemary Chicken

Brining

1. Toss the Herbamare, sugar, pepper and garlic into a pot and cover with 2 cups of boiling water. Stir.

2. Add 1 litre of cold water­ and place the chicken into the pot. Cover and refrigerate for at least 3 hours and up to 6.

Once the brining is completed discard the liquid and roast the chicken using this fab roast chicken recipe below.

Juicy Roasted Rosemary Chicken

1. Preheat the oven to 450ºF. Pour one tablespoon of oil on baking sheet.

2. Flatten the chicken by pressing down on the breast, then break the joints between the body and the legs to flatten the legs as well. Rub the chicken with the butter.

3. Slice 3 cloves of garlic into thin strips then put some into the bird cavity and tuck the rest under the skin. Do the same with 3 rosemary sprigs.

4. Season generously with Herbamare and pepper, then place the chicken on the sheet, breast side down.

5. Cook 15 min in the middle of the oven, then lower the temperature to 375ºF and cook an additional 30-35 min.

6. Put potatoes into a bowl and pour in the remaining oil.

7. Press the remaining garlic cloves then add them to the bowl. Add the remaining rosemary leaves stripped from the stem, whole. Season with Herbamare and pepper then mix well.

8. Take the sheet with the chicken out of the oven, turn the chicken breast side up, then arrange the potatoes all around it.

9. Cook an additional 40-45 min, until the potatoes and chicken are golden-coloured and fully cooked. to prevent excessive sticking, loosen the potatoes from the sheet once or twice during cooking, without turning them over.

10. For a nicely coloured and crisp skin, turn on the top broiler for the last 2 min. Let stand 3-5 min before serving.
